Sony is likely to release a mid-generation refresh PS5 Pro this year an analyst has told news site CNBC. The analyst said that launching the PS5 Pro would boost interest in the PS5 after Sony cut its sales targets for the console.

It would also mean that Sony has some serious console power on the market, ready for the launch of the highly anticipated Grand Theft Auto 6.

In a recent earnings presentation, Sony CEO Hiroki Totoki said that PS5 suffered a decline in sales in the current quarter and that the company expected to miss its shipment targets of 25 million units. Totoki also stated that the PS5 was now in the “latter half” of the console life cycle.

The PlayStation 4, which launched in 2013 got a revised PS4 Pro in November 2016. Three years after it’s initial launch. We are now entering PS5’s fourth year, so it seems the right time to launch a Pro revision.

PS5 Pro launching this year

Serkan Toto, a Tokyo-based Games Consultant seems to think that Sony will launch the PS5 Pro in the second half of this year. The consultant told CNBC, “There seems to be a broad consensus in the game industry that Sony is indeed preparing a launch of a PS5 Pro in the second half of 2024.”

The consultant continued, “And Sony will want to make sure to have a great piece of hardware ready when GTA VI hits in 2025, a launch that will be a shot in the arm for the entire gaming industry.”

In December last year, specs allegedly leaked for the PS5 Pro. The specs show a beefed-up PS5 that will be a ray-tracing powerhouse.

Sony has yet to officially confirm the existence of the PS5 Pro but some gaming insiders think that dev kits for the mid-gen refresh console have already shipped out to developers. If Sony is planning on releasing the Pro this year, it shouldn;t be too long until we hear some official news.
